18 products

Sold Out

10ml
50VG
10mg
20mg
3 For £9.99

Sold Out

10ml
50VG
10mg
20mg
3 For £9.99

Sold Out

10ml
50VG
10mg
20mg
3 For £9.99

Sold Out

10ml
50VG
10mg
20mg
3 For £9.99

Sold Out

10ml
50VG
10mg
20mg
3 For £9.99

Sold Out

10ml
50VG
10mg
20mg
3 For £9.99

 

img

Added to cart successfully!

Wishlist